X-Ray Tech Job Description in Pomeroy WA

Pomeroy WA radiologic technologist examining x-rayThere are multiple professional designations for x-ray techs (technicians or technologists). They can also be called radiologic technologists, radiologic technicians, radiographers or radiology techs. Regardless of the name, they all have the same major job function, which is to use imaging machines to internally visualize patients for the objective of diagnosis and treatment. Some radiologic technologists may also administer radiation therapy for treating cancer. Many choose to perform as generalists, while there are those that have chosen a specialization, for instance mammography. They may work in Pomeroy WA clinics, hospitals, family practices or outpatient diagnostic imaging centers. The imaging technologies that an X-Ray technologist might work with include:

  • Traditional and specialized X-Rays
  • Computerized tomography (CT) or “CAT” scans
  •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I)
  • Sonography or ultrasound
  • Fluoroscopy

Radiographers have to maintain their equipment and also routinely analyze its functionality and safety. They are also expected to retain in-depth records of all of their diagnostic procedures. As health practitioners, they are held to a high professional standard and code of conduct.

Radiology Tech Degrees near Pomeroy WA

Pomeroy WA x-ray tech school internship programThe primary requirement for attending a radiology tech school is to have attained a high school diploma or GED. Radiologic technologist students have the choice to earn either an Associate or a Bachelor’s Degree. An Associate Degree, which is the most common among technicians, generally requires 18 months to two years to complete depending on the program and course load. A Bachelor’s Degree will take more time at up to 4 years to finish and is more extensive in scope. Most students select a degree major in Radiography, but there are other related majors that may be acceptable also. Something to consider is that radiographer colleges have a clinical training or lab component as a component of their course of study. It can often be fulfilled by participating in an internship or externship program which many colleges offer through local clinics and hospitals in Pomeroy WA or their area. Once you have graduated from one of the degree programs, you will need to comply with any licensing or certification mandates in Washington or the state you will be working as applicable.

Radiographer Certification and Licensing

Once you have graduated from an Radiologist school, based on the state where you will be working you may need to be licensed. Most states do mandate licensing, and their criteria vary so get in touch with your state. Currently, all states that do require licensure will recognize The American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) certification exam for the purpose of licensing, but a number accept additional alternatives for testing as well. Several states also call for certification as a component of the licensing process, otherwise it is voluntary. Having said that, many Pomeroy area employers would rather hire radiology techs that have earned certification so it might increase your career options in and around Pomeroy WA to earn certification. ARRT’s certification program calls for graduation from an accepted program as well as a passing score on their comprehensive examination. ARRT also calls for re-certification every other year, which may be satisfied with 24 credits of continuing education, or by passing an exam.

Are the Radiology Tech Colleges Accredited? A large number of radiology tech schools have earned some type of accreditation, whether regional or national. Even so, it’s still crucial to confirm that the school and program are accredited. Among the most highly respected accrediting agencies in the field of radiology is the Joint Review Committee on Education in Radiologic Technology (JRCERT). Programs earning accreditation from the JRCERT have undergone a detailed assessment of their teachers and educational materials. If the program is online it can also earn acc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which targets distance or online learning. All accrediting organizations should be acknowledged by the U.S. Department of Education or the Council on Higher Education Accreditation. Besides guaranteeing a superior education, accreditation will also assist in acquiring financial assistance and student loans, which are frequently not available for non-accredited colleges. Accreditation can also be a pre-requisite for certification and licensing as required. And a number of Pomeroy WA employers will only hire graduates of an accredited college for entry-level jobs.

    Pomeroy, Washington

    The Nez Perce trail existed in the area before history was recorded, and the first written record of caucasians passing through the area were Lewis and Clark in 1805. Captain Benjamin Bonneville also passed through the future site of the town while he was surveying for the US government in 1834. In 1860, an Irish settler named Parson Quinn settled just east of present-day Pomeroy, and lived there for the next 40 years. Rancher Joseph M. Pomeroy purchased the land in 1864,[8] and platted the town's site in May 1878.[9][10]

    Pomeroy was officially incorporated on February 3, 1886. The town has been the seat of Garfield County since 1882, despite fierce competition in the 1880s with neighboring towns Pataha and Asotin. The struggle to name a county seat would continue through both houses of the Washington Territorial Legislature in 1883, to Governor William A. Newell of the Washington Territory, and eventually reached the Congress in 1884.[8]

    On July 18, 1900 (despite a city ordinance which mandated fire-proof materials for downtown buildings; there had been fires in 1890 and 1898 as well) fire destroyed half of the small town's business district. The recovery took two years as the destroyed buildings were rebuilt using brick - a building boom for the small community.[11] In 1912, the City voted to outlaw the manufacture or sale of alcohol. This prohibition quickly led to rampant bootlegging and corruption which lasted until the 21st Amendment passed in 1933.[12]
